Notice is hereby given that effective immediately, the Skeleton Fire Area and adjacent lands as legally described below is closed to all motorized vehicle use, except those defined as open roads. The purpose of this closure is to protect wildlife (including critical deer range), vegetation, sensitive soils, watershed resources, areas of high visual quality, and to prevent spread of noxious weeds. Exemptions to this closure will apply to administrative personnel of the Bureau of Land Management. Other exemptions to this closure order may be made on a case by case basis by the authorized officer.
